Statement of the problem.

Matters that relate to school safety have generated wide acclaim (V.P.C.C, 1995). The efficiency of the safety of schools has been known to have educational implications on the students and this has been ascertained though the Creemers’ multilevel model that seeks to assess the impact of school safety. School models are integral in ensuring that safety in schools does not affect the performance of students (Ventura, 1994). School safety is a critical aspect that may have an impact on the education of the pupil or the student by influencing the immediate environment of the student (Bowen & Bowen, 1999). The learning environment of the schools is integral as it provides the built environment through which information can flow. School safety is considered as a common problem that may lead to inconveniences for the student. The environment in which the school is situated may pose several risks for the school and may compromise the safety of the institution. Students that are in safe schools are usually not concerned with the probability of being victimized and it may be argued that they can dedicate more of their time to school and can therefore excel in their academics. The impact of school safety on the performance of the student has been an issue that has affected students especially from lower levels of learning.

Rationale

The School Safety Center provides resources to districts and schools to help in the development of high-quality emergency operations and safety plans. Feeling safe is fundamental for a positive learning environment. Conversely, integrating all the learning supports for instance social services, mental health, behavioral, are all perceived as being the cohesive approaches which ultimately enhances multidisciplinary collaboration of the entire school (Shafii & Shafii, 2001). Likewise, implementing such an approach means that prevention as well as the promotion of the needs of the students will be easily catered for so as to enhance their performance.

In addition to that, improving the general access to the school-based student mental health should be supported by efficient staffing levels i.e. the employment of mental health professional who will aid in infusing intervention and prevention services. This in return will assist in integrating services which are to be offered to the students through school-community partnership (Hester, 2003). Moreover, integrating the ongoing safety and positive climate assist in crisis prevention, response, recovery, and enhancing the preparedness of the students. This is what will reinforce learning, efficient use of the prevailing resources, effective threat evaluation, and so on.

Conversely, balancing psychological and physical safety in the process of avoiding overly restrictive measures basically will have the capacity of undermining the students’ learning environment (Hester, 2003). Contrary to that, it is essential to combine other security measures with the effort of enhancing positive school climate, trust building, encouraging students to have effective response to any potential threats, and so on  (Shafii & Shafii, 2001).
